Beispiel #1
0
        /// <summary>
        /// 双击datagridview单元格进入浏览窗体
        /// </summary>
        /// <param name="dgvView">双击的datagridview</param>
        /// <param name="strIdName">datagridview中数据Id的name</param>
        private void DoubleClickCell(DataGridView dgvView, string strIdName)
        {
            if (dgvView.CurrentRow == null)
            {
                return;
            }
            strReId = dgvView.CurrentRow.Cells[strIdName].Value.ToString();
            UCOldPartsReceiptView view = new UCOldPartsReceiptView(strReId);

            base.addUserControl(view, "旧件收货单-预览", "view" + strReId, this.Tag.ToString(), this.Name);
        }
Beispiel #2
0
        /// <summary>
        /// 根据选型卡切换判断是哪个选选项卡而执行预览
        /// </summary>
        private void DataView()
        {
            string strTabTag = tcQuery.SelectedIndex.ToString();//0为按旧件收货单查询,1为按配件查询旧件收货单

            if (strTabTag == "0")
            {
                if (!IsCheck(dgvRData, strTabTag))
                {
                    return;
                }
            }
            else if (strTabTag == "1")
            {
                if (!IsCheck(dgvPartsData, strTabTag))
                {
                    return;
                }
            }
            UCOldPartsReceiptView Qview = new UCOldPartsReceiptView(strReId);

            base.addUserControl(Qview, "旧件收货单-预览", "Qview" + strReId, this.Tag.ToString(), this.Name);
        }